#c6479c h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#c6479c is composed of 77.6% red, 27.8%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.1% magenta, 21.2%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 319.8 degrees, a saturation of 52.7% and a lightness of 52.7%. #c6479c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8eff with #8d0039.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

● #c6479c color description : Moderate pink.
The hexadecimal color #c6479c has RGB values of R:198, G:71,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.64, Y:0.21,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 12994460.
